Hi Esra,

my Pathos and Dyns sound amazing, many people say to me that it is two brands that they never would mix together, but I dont get too well with stereotypes... So, the more I listen to other system the more I like mine...

I've got a smooth and silky midrange, very fast and tight bass, and never edgy but with lot of detail. With so e recording i can almost see texture in the soundstadge.

the Hugo didn't add much to what I already have, I don't want to be a spoiler about this DAC, but Rega DAC USB input is a work of art made by Rega, it is a completely different circutery from the optical and coax that don't get close to the USB input regarding sound quality, the only downside is being limited to 16/48.

i really hope that in the new DAC Rega will add a async USB input...

This winter got a new home, and was a little nervous about the new room acoustics, as my system was build and tuned to my old living room.

After the system being connected in the new living room my jaw dropped completely , as a matter of fact it was the biggest upgrade of all time! The new room is bigger and wider, the Dyns are a bit more apart from each other what gives a wider sound stage, and it is now easier to pin out the instruments in front of me.
